What Reviewers are Saying: Surviving Summer Camp

It’s been an incredible few months for Eddy and his brothers! Since the release of Surviving Summer Camp, the middle-grade blogging community has been diving into the wilderness with the Breau brothers—and the feedback has been heart-pounding and heartwarming.

Whether you are a parent looking for a book to hook a reluctant reader or a teacher searching for the next great classroom adventure, here is a look at what the experts are saying:

"The 30 Chapters Zip By" — Always in the Middle

Greg Pattridge at Always in the Middle highlighted exactly what I hoped readers would find: a fast-paced journey that keeps you turning pages.

"The 30 chapters zip by with the engaging narration by young Eddy... Fast-paced with plenty of laughs that will appeal to the reluctant reader."

"Fans of Hatchet will Love This" — Log Cabin Library

One of the highest compliments a survival story can receive is a comparison to Gary Paulsen’s classic. Brenda at Log Cabin Library noted the "edge-of-your-seat" tension.

"Along with Surviving Summer Camp, they’re all action-packed where characters are plunged into the wild and have these edge-of-your-seat tense moments that keep you flying through the pages."

"Unexpectedly Deep" — Briar’s Reviews

Briar took a deep dive into Eddy's character arc, focusing on the growth that happens when you're forced out of your comfort zone (and away from your snacks!).

"Unexpectedly deep... perfect for readers who like high-stakes and character growth. I highly recommend this book for any middle grader." Read the full review here

"A Heart-Pounding Survival Story" — Bookworm for Kids

For the younger end of the middle-grade spectrum, the team at Bookworm for Kids noted how relatable Eddy’s "indoor kid" personality is for modern children.

"Fans of Holes, Hatchet, or Restart will love this heart-pounding survival story... A laugh-out-loud, heart-pounding survival story."
